The Opportunity

We are seeking a Senior Accounts Payable Coordinator (mid-level) to join our Firm.This position will be based in our Chicago office (hybrid).This position assists with the daily operations of the department including coordinating workflow, processing accounts payable transactions, reconciling accounts, and maintaining databases. Handles complex department assignments and special projects as needed. Oversees and assists with the management of client escrow accounts. Assists with monthly and annual budget documentation and back-up as needed.

  • Oversees department workflow, prioritizes assignments, identifies additional resources, and employs problem-solving techniques to complete assignments and meet deadlines.
  • Assists with special projects as needed.
  • Processes petty cash vouchers and advances and enters information into accounting system for reimbursement. Conducts reconciliation of petty cash account.
  • Processes checks for filing fees and miscellaneous operating expenses while ensuring appropriate documentation and approval.
  • Maintains database of checks written and manages monthly reconciliation of filing fees and checking accounts.
  • Conducts reconciliation of monthly use of Chicago office credit card.
  • Sorts and distributes rush checks from NY office.
  • Codes and processes invoices utilizing accounting software, obtains and verifies appropriate approvals, and allocates expenses as appropriate. Responds to inquiries as needed and follows up on past due notices.
  • Handles Aderant input for escrow transactions.
  • Provides Escrow account balance information as needed.
  • Assists with the transferring of escrow account funds.
  • Assists with department budget queries and processes transfers as needed.
  • Reviews, signs, and processes accounting system sessions and expense reports. Follows up as needed with support staff and attorneys when additional information is required.
  • Maintains inventory of safe contents.
  • Responds to office inquiries and handles or directs to appropriate contact as needed.
  • Creates and maintains vendor and department files.
  • Acts as resource for department staff.
